State Bank of India began its operations in Australia in 1998 and has since played a crucial role in fostering trade between India and Australia through trade finance products. We operate under the oversight of the Reserve Bank of India and Australian Prudential Regulation Authority (APRA), providing services such as deposits, remittances, trade finance solutions, and syndicated loans. Job Summary:

The Trade Finance Officer is responsible for managing and executing trade finance transactions, including Letters of Credit (LCs), bill negotiations, buyer’s credit, and related operational tasks. This role ensures the accuracy and efficiency of trade finance operations, upholds high standards of document management, and delivers exceptional service to clients and internal st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ities:

A. Trade Finance Management:

CRM and Account Corrections: Perform monthly CRM/account corrections and maintain accurate records.
Document Checking and Forwarding: Review and forward documents (bill lodgement) for customers, ensuring compliance with bank procedures.
Bill Discounting and RA Transactions: Input bill discounting and RA transactions, prepare sanctions, and manage related processes.
Buyer’s Credit, Supplier’s Credit and MRPA Transactions: Input buyer’s credit supplier’s credit and MRPA transactions, prepare sanctions, and manage related processes
Due Diligence: Conduct due diligence using tools such as Purple Trac, Dow Jones, and Accuity.
LC Management:
Add LC confirmations and handle LC lodgement and subsequent amendments in TI Plus.
Manage LC advising in the TI Plus system and coordinate with back-office teams for accurate processing.
SWIFT Messaging: Handle and prepare SWIFT messages related to bills and LCs (MT799, MT742, MT710).

B. Buyer’s Credit and Bill Negotiation:

Customer Maintenance: Oversee customer maintenance, account openings, and disbursements of all buyer’s credit.
Query Management: Respond to queries from branches regarding buyer’s credit/SC/RA via phone and email.
Bill Negotiation: Negotiate bills under documentary credit, including proposals and control reports for committee approvals.
Document Verification: Verify documents presented under documentary credit and manage import/export bills in TI Plus.
Filing and Maintenance: Maintain records of confirmed and unconfirmed LCs, send financial advice, and statements.
Coordination with Local Clientele: Coordinate with local clients regarding discounting transactions, LC issuance, amendments, and document couriering.
Follow-Up and Reconciliation: Follow up with banks/officers for payment reminders, overdue buyer’s credit, and reconcile trade finance entries.
Rollover and Closing: Manage rollover and closure of buyer’s credit/RA accounts, ensuring timely processing.
C. BG Issuance:

Proposals and Control Reports: Create proposals and control reports for committee approval for BG issuance.
Issuance and Communication: Issue BGs, send draft copies to customers via email, and handle entry of inward and outward guarantees in Finacle.
Coordination and Charges: Coordinate with counter-guarantee issuing branches for BG issuance and share charges.
Charge Recovery: Send SWIFT messages/letters for recovery of charges and ensure timely recovery.
Advising and Closure: Advise the Guarantee advising bank upon BG expiry and manage reversal and closure of guarantees.
